Guys just wondering, in 3ds max, how do you seperate the bolt from sniper rifles so you could animate those?
Like for instance im trying to seperate a bolt from the l96 so i could animate it
Learn for yourself, god damn it this thread was almost dead and you bumped the shit out of this... ._.
1. Select the rifle.
2.
select "element" and then select the bolt, if it selects too much then select the bolt with "polygon" (you can select multiple stuff by holding "ctrl" (i think, or is it shift??)
3. click "detach"
Also, to add to this. You'll probably need to edit the pivot of the object after detaching. At the top right there is a hierarchy tab (looks like a box with three boxes underneath it) Select the bolt, click that tab, click "affect pivot only" then "center to object" That's normally what I do. I always have to do this when I detach something because for some reason it throws the pivot way off.

I'll let you know how I do shoot animations and see if this helps you. I normally only have it set to 15 to 16 frames for a scene. Frame 0: Have the gun dip down slightly, and slightly moved backwards. Frame 1: Have the gun at it highest recoil that you want it to be at. From what I notice, moving back always seems to look better than excessive upward movement imo. Now this next few parts you can kinda edit to see what looks best for you. At around frame 7-9 have the gun move forward some and a slight dip down, but don't have it moved all the way to the origin. The rest of the animation is yours to mess with the return to origin; whether you want to have it slide back into place (by not editing it further) or having it dip or bounce back.
You can do the same thing with a different style of shoots instead of recoiling upwards, you can have the gun rotate up, but using the move tool down for frame 1, then adjusting from there. The best way you can see with that kind of shoot is with broke's mp5 animations or his first ak47 set.
